Prevent diarrhea through food containing prebiotic bacteria

One of the conditions that affect children and that are taken into account due to the frequency and consequences, is childhood diarrhea. Liquid stools, loss of fluids in the body and loss of electrolytes such as sodium or potassium are some of the characteristics of this condition. It is important to be able to prevent it, given the high rate of contagion it presents. For this reason, the World Health Organization recommends that normal milk be replaced by fermented milk, since it contains effective and indicated prebiotic bacteria for the treatment and prevention of diarrhea.

One of the prebiotic bacteria that we can know due to television commercials is Lactobacillus Casei Imunitas, this type of bacteria can counteract the consequences that arise from diarrhea and its severity. How does this bacterium work in the organism of the child? Thanks to it, a necessary balance is produced in the intestinal flora of the child, it causes the intestinal mucosa to have a better structure in addition to developing it and the defensive systems of the intestine are greatly reinforced against possible conditions.

An effective prevention through foods containing prebiotic bacteria It is one of the best solutions, although we know that the highest rate of this condition is during the summer, it is important to start preparing the child's defensive system and improve intestinal health as soon as possible. An adequate diet where healthy foods intervene will allow a healthier and more protected body.
